What Are the Common Symptoms That Indicate You Need to Replace Your Dell XPS 15z Battery?

The common symptoms indicating that you need to replace your Dell XPS 15z battery include decreased battery life, unexpected shutdowns, swelling, and overheating.

  1. Decreased Battery Life
  2. Unexpected Shutdowns
  3. Swelling
  4. Overheating

These symptoms can appear alone or in combination. It is essential to understand each symptom to make an informed decision about battery replacement.

  1. Decreased Battery Life:
    Decreased battery life occurs when the battery cannot hold a charge for an adequate period. Users may notice that their laptop discharges quickly, even with light use. According to research by Battery University, after around 300 to 500 charge cycles, lithium-ion batteries, like those in Dell laptops, typically lose about 20% of their original capacity.

  2. Unexpected Shutdowns:
    Unexpected shutdowns happen when the laptop turns off suddenly, often due to inadequate power supply from the battery. This can lead to data loss and disruptions in work. Studies show that age and wear of the battery are primary contributors to such incidents, indicating a need for replacement.

  3. Swelling:
    Swelling of the battery is a physical distortion caused by gas buildup inside the battery cells. This condition poses safety hazards. The Dell XPS 15z battery can swell when subjected to heat or age-related degradation. The National Fire Protection Association has raised concerns regarding swollen batteries as potential fire hazards.

  4. Overheating:
    Overheating occurs when the battery generates excessive heat during operation or charging. The Dell XPS 15z may run hot to the touch, which can impair performance and cause hardware damage. Research published by the IEEE shows that prolonged exposure to high temperatures can significantly shorten battery lifespan and performance.

Recognizing these symptoms can help you determine when to seek a replacement, ensuring your device operates safely and effectively.

What Tools Do You Need for Replacing the Dell XPS 15z Battery?

To replace the Dell XPS 15z battery, you need specific tools to complete the task effectively.

  1. Tools required for battery replacement:
    – Phillips #0 screwdriver
    – Plastic pry tool
    – Anti-static wrist strap (optional)
    – Magnetic parts tray (optional)

It is essential to gather these tools before starting the battery replacement process. The right tools ensure a smoother experience and reduce the risk of damaging the laptop.

  1. Phillips #0 screwdriver:
    The Phillips #0 screwdriver is necessary for removing the screws from the laptop’s base. This type of screwdriver is commonly used in electronics. It provides a secure fit into the screw head, allowing for easier torque and grip during unscrewing. Many laptop disassembly guides specify this screwdriver for similar models.

  2. Plastic pry tool:
    The plastic pry tool helps to gently open the laptop casing without damaging the surface. Its flat edge slips between parts and allows for the release of clips without scratching or breaking any plastic components. Users often find that using a plastic tool reduces the risk of static discharge compared to metal tools.

  3. Anti-static wrist strap (optional):
    The anti-static wrist strap prevents electrostatic discharge from damaging internal parts. It grounds the user, directing any built-up static electricity away from sensitive components. While not mandatory, it is a recommended safety measure when working inside electronic devices.

  4. Magnetic parts tray (optional):
    A magnetic parts tray keeps screws and small components organized during the replacement process. Users can avoid losing screws by placing them in the tray as they disassemble the laptop. This tool is especially helpful for those unfamiliar with component organization during repairs.

In summary, using the right tools such as a Phillips #0 screwdriver and a plastic pry tool can make the battery replacement process for a Dell XPS 15z efficient and safe.

What Are the Step-by-Step Instructions for Installing a New Dell XPS 15z Battery?

To install a new Dell XPS 15z battery, follow these step-by-step instructions for a successful replacement.

  1. Gather the necessary tools: Phillips screwdriver, plastic spudger (optional), and antistatic wrist strap (optional).
  2. Power down the laptop and unplug it from the wall.
  3. Remove the back cover screws using the Phillips screwdriver.
  4. Use a plastic spudger to gently pry off the back cover.
  5. Disconnect the battery cable from the motherboard.
  6. Remove the battery screws.
  7. Lift the battery out of its compartment.
  8. Insert the new battery in place.
  9. Reconnect the battery cable to the motherboard.
  10. Replace the back cover and tighten the screws.
  11. Power on the laptop to check the new battery functionality.

How Can You Extend the Lifespan of Your Dell XPS 15z Battery?

You can extend the lifespan of your Dell XPS 15z battery by following optimal charging habits, managing power settings, and maintaining proper temperature conditions.

Optimal charging habits include avoiding complete discharges and not keeping the laptop plugged in all the time. Lithium-ion batteries, such as those in the Dell XPS 15z, perform best when they operate between 20% and 80% charge levels. A study from Battery University (2020) suggests that frequently allowing the battery to drop below 20% can result in increased wear and tear over time.

Managing power settings can also improve battery longevity. Setting your laptop to power-saving modes reduces energy consumption. Lowering screen brightness and turning off Bluetooth and Wi-Fi when not in use can further conserve battery life. Research from the International Journal of Engineering and Technology (2021) shows that these practices can significantly reduce power drain.

Maintaining proper temperature conditions is crucial for battery health. Lithium-ion batteries degrade quicker in high temperatures. Keeping the laptop in a cool, dry environment can prolong battery lifespan. Avoid using the laptop on soft surfaces that might block ventilation. A report by IEEE Access (2019) emphasizes that devices operating above 30°C (86°F) may reduce battery capacity by up to 20%.

Implementing these strategies can significantly help in extending the lifespan of your Dell XPS 15z battery.
